Early Career and Arrival in MLB: Setting the Stage

Before we get into the nitty-gritty of Shohei Ohtani's home run stats, let's rewind and look at how it all began. Ohtani's journey to MLB wasn't your typical path. Hailing from Japan, he made a name for himself as a star pitcher and hitter in the Nippon Professional Baseball (NPB) league. This dual-threat ability immediately piqued the interest of MLB teams, and the chase for Ohtani's signature was on.

When Ohtani finally made the leap to the Los Angeles Angels in 2018, the baseball world watched with bated breath. Could he truly do both – pitch and hit – at the highest level? The answer, as we've all witnessed, is a resounding yes. His debut season was a whirlwind of excitement, showcasing his potential on the mound and at the plate.
